MAX16026TE+ belongs to the category of integrated circuits (ICs).
This product is commonly used for voltage monitoring and reset functions in various electronic devices.
MAX16026TE+ is available in a small surface-mount package, making it suitable for compact electronic designs.
The essence of MAX16026TE+ lies in its ability to monitor voltage levels and provide a reset signal when necessary, ensuring proper functioning of electronic devices.

The MAX16026TE+ operates by continuously monitoring the input voltage using an internal voltage reference. When the input voltage falls below the preset threshold voltage, the device generates a reset signal. This reset signal can be used to initiate a system reset or perform other necessary actions. The device also includes a manual reset option, allowing users to manually trigger a reset when required.
